0 ^. I, v) d' @) iNatural Treasure Program& n3 |0 \1 U5 u
+ U( z/ i) q: a- F& a8 l( SOn September 25, 2011 the John Janzen Nature Centre will launch the Natural Treasure Program, an exciting new initiative from the Robert Bateman Get to Know Program.6 y) T# H5 s+ Z; H$ D
3 _! n5 K1 H* a: ONatural Treasure uses technology to provide youth with a unique outdoor experience. Participants follow a map or GPS device to complete an outdoor scavenger hunt by finding clues hidden around the Nature Centre.! G+ {' p3 N6 g) Q0 ]) T
1 w$ \# P( Y/ b" [0 b. ^3 x
Next, participants head online for some fun challenges, games, and stories, all of which relate to their experience outdoors. The program is geared towards helping youth get to know Edmonton’s wildlife.
: _- k% y3 l( w: T% l. e' Z/ X3 G9 f% Z. B1 f% a( U
